The Variation Of NOS Positive Neurons In Amygdala During The Estrus Cycle And Following Ovariectomy In Female Rat

Objective:To study morphological change of nitric oxide synthase(NOS) positive neurons of amygdala in the estrus cycle and following ovariectomy in female rat. Method:By using the SABC immunohistochemical and the image analysis technique. Result:(1)The anterior amygdaloid area, the nucleus amygdaloideus basalis,the nucleus amygdaloideus lateralis and the nucleus amygdaloideus medialis are the main positive staining cell areas of amygdala. Besides that ,NOS positive nucleus cells are found in the nucleus amygdaloideus centralis and the nucleus amygdaloideus corticalis.(2)NOS positive nucleus cells of the nucleus amygdaloideus basalis and the nucleus amygdaloideus medialis have significant change during different estrus cycles:the amount of NOS positive neurons during the proestrus and the metaestrus increases more significantly than that during the estrus and the anestrus. But in the nucleus amygdaloideus lateralis,there is not apparent variation during different estrus cycles.(3)In the ovariectomy(OVX)2 months group, the amount of NOS positive neurons in the nucleus amygdaloideus basalis and the nucleus amygdaloideus medialis decreases more significantly than that in the intact group.But NOS positive neurons in the nucleus amygdaloideus lateralis have no significant difference between the OVX 2 months group and the intact group. Conclusion: In vivo, the level of estrogen positively regulates the amount of NOS positive neurons in some nuclei of amygdala.
